自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(44)
  • 资源 (1)
  • 收藏
  • 关注

原创 vs2019+openmvg2.0+openmvs2.0+windows详细安装编译

3 编译配置3.1 环境和工具 - Win10 64bit - VS 2019 社区版(地址:Download Visual Studio Tools - Install Free for Windows, Mac, Linux) - CMake 解压版 (地址:Download | CMake)3.2 文件准备 -OpenMVG,地址:https://github.com/openMVG/openMVG/releases...

2022-05-16 11:33:03 2289 1

原创 程序优化策略

内容自己搜索

2014-07-10 09:37:33 429

原创 vc中调用dll传参数

1)参数一定要对应上,比如int64跟int是有区别的,会出错2)string的参数不要用,这个容易出现编码问题

2014-06-29 20:10:32 671

原创 VC中调用MinGW的dll

1) makefile.debug中加入

2014-06-28 10:01:34 1528

翻译 mingw编译thrif和boost

编译thrift:Windows SetupThe windows compiler is available as a prebuilt exe available hereWindows setup from sourceBasic requirements for win32Thrift's compiler is written in C++

2014-06-28 08:45:56 1060

原创 qt下配置opencv环境注意事项

1.使用32位mingw-g++ 不能搭配64位opencv库2.

2014-06-05 11:07:28 461

原创 valgrind 的使用简介

一  valgrind是什么?Valgrind是一套Linux下,开放源代码(GPL V2)的仿真调试工具的集合。Valgrind由内核(core)以及基于内核的其他调试工具组成。内核类似于一个框架(framework),它模拟了一个CPU环境,并提供服务给其他工具;而其他工具则类似于插件 (plug-in),利用内核提供的服务完成各种特定的内存调试任务。Valgrind的体系结构

2014-05-06 17:25:52 418

转载 对经典的Hough 变换的理解

Hough 变换的原理Hough 变换的原理就是利用图像全局特征将边缘像素连接起来组成区域封闭边界,它将图像空间转换到参数空间,在参数空间对点进行描述,达到检测图像边缘的目的。该方法把所有可能落在边缘上的点进行统计计算,根据对数据的统计结果确定属于边缘的程度。Hough 变换的实质就是对图像进行坐标变换,把平面坐标变换为参数坐标,使变换的结果更易识别和检测。对经典的Hough 变换

2014-01-21 16:17:35 1051

转载 为什么opencv的canny函数检测边缘的效果和matlab的不同

先上两张经过处理后的图片进行对比 1、opencv2、matlab 可以明显的看出matlab的边缘更为细腻。 首先回顾一下传统的canny算法的主要步骤:1、使用sobel差分算子求出灰度图像的x和y方向导数;2、求出图像各点梯度大小及其方向;3、设置高低两个阈值,梯度大于高阈值为强边像素点,大于低阈值为潜在

2014-01-17 15:38:33 895

原创 download prerequisites from the same location as my application

用vs2010制作安装包 打包先决条件程序时,选择download prerequisites from the same location as my application在Program Files\Microsoft SDKs\Windows\v7.0A\Bootstrapper\Packages\DotNetFX40Client\zh-Hans目录下将dotNetFx40LP_Cli

2014-01-13 14:10:39 1873

转载 vs2010打包程序制作的快捷方式指向错误的位置(指向安装包文件) 导致每次启动都要windows正在配置

刚刚开发完成的一个WPF项目,使用VS2010自带的打包工具对它进行打包(设置开始菜单的快捷方式),安装后,发现快捷方式的目标指向有问题。这里我主要想说明打包后进行安装完毕后,快捷方式的指向问题。1、打包后生成文件说明     我们都知道通过VS工具自带的打包后会生成两个文件,一个是exe文件,一个是msi文件。需要说明的是msi文件时window installer开发出

2014-01-10 15:37:15 4959

转载 压缩跟踪Compressive Tracking

好了,学习了解了稀疏感知的理论知识后,终于可以来学习《Real-Time Compressive Tracking》这个paper介绍的感知跟踪算法了。自己英文水平有限,理解难免出错,还望各位不吝指正。      下面是这个算法的工程网站:里面包含了上面这篇论文、Matlab和C++版本的代码,还有测试数据、demo等。后面我再学习学习里面的C++版本的代码,具体见博客更新。htt

2014-01-05 21:46:43 530

原创 tld使用中遇到的问题

1)TLD.h:50:3: 错误: ‘PatchGenerator’不是命名空间‘cv’中的一个类型名解决:#include

2014-01-03 10:12:26 798

原创 OpenCV 2.4.2: Undefined References

yuwuzhi@yuwuzhi:~/project/2013/tennis/project/opencvblob$ makeg++    -c -o blob_tracker.o blob_tracker.cppIn file included from /usr/include/stdio.h:27:0,                 from blob_tracker.cpp:2

2014-01-02 11:05:53 6218 1

转载 矩阵及其运算

§1 矩阵及其运算教学要求 : 理解矩阵的定义、掌握矩阵的基本律、掌握几类特殊矩阵(比如零矩阵,单位矩阵,对称矩阵和反对称矩阵 ) 的定义与性质、注意矩阵运算与通常数的运算异同。能熟练正确地进行矩阵的计算。知识要点 :一、矩阵的基本概念矩阵,是由 个数组成的一个  行 列的矩形表格,通常用大写字母  表示,组成矩阵的每一个数,均称为矩阵的元素,通常用小写字母其元素  表示,其中下标

2013-12-26 15:35:45 708

转载 linux中编译静态库(.a)和动态库(.so)的基本方法

静态库        在linux环境中, 使用ar命令创建静态库文件.如下是命令的选项:           d -----从指定的静态库文件中删除文件           m -----把文件移动到指定的静态库文件中           p -----把静态库文件中指定的文件输出到标准输出           q -----快速地把文件追加到静态库文件中

2013-12-24 22:07:35 500

转载 Ubuntu 12.04中文输入法的安装

Ubuntu 12.04中文输入法的安装 Ubuntu上的输入法主要有小小输入平台(支持拼音/二笔/五笔等),Fcitx,Ibus,Scim等。其中Scim和Ibus是输入法框架。在Ubuntu的中文系统中自带了中文输入法,通过Ctrl+Space可切换中英文输入法。这里我们主要说下Ubuntu英文系统中,中文输入法的安装。安装输入法的第一步,是安装语言包。我们选择

2013-12-19 14:35:50 395

转载 Ubuntu 12.04 输入法托盘图标消失

安装完Ubuntu 12.04后,发现输入法托盘图表有时会找不到,但是按Ctrl+Space键仍然能够唤出输入法。网上查找了下,据说是Beta版就存在这个Bug了。解决办法:  1、重启输入法(临时)  在终端(Terminal)[快捷键 Ctrl+Alt+T]里面输入:1 killall ibus-daemon2 ibus-daemon -d   2、彻底解

2013-12-19 14:23:03 446

转载 Ubuntu Locale配置问题根源解决之道

1. No such file 用locale命令的时候就会出现locale: Cannot set LC_CTYPE to default locale: No such file or directorylocale: Cannot set LC_MESSAGES to default locale: No such file or directorylocale: Canno

2013-12-19 14:21:07 525

转载 Locale

关于locale的设定,为什么要设定locale[编辑]关于locale的设定locale是国际化与本土化过程中的一个非常重要的概念,个人认为,对于中文用户来说,通常会涉及到的国际化或者本土化,大致包含三个方面:看中文,写中文,与window中文系统的兼容和通信。从实际经验上看来,locale的设定与看中文关系不大,但是与写中文,及window分区的挂载方式有很密切的关系。本人认为

2013-12-19 14:03:43 444

转载 ubuntu英文版变成中文版

适用于ubuntu 12.04英文版的系统,其它版本的设置应该是大同小异的。进入ubuntu系统,在顶部齿状标志找到system...2.在personal找到Language Support3.进入Language Support后,在language的页面中点击Install/Remove Languages...

2013-12-19 10:27:09 592

转载 Linux下matlab中文乱码的解决

从网上下了个simsun字体,问题果然解决,特此记录一下具体步骤如下:1、打开matlab字体所在目录,我的是/home/tt/local/matlab/sys/java/jre/glnxa64/jre/lib/fonts,建立一个新的目录,比如名字是test,命令如下:$mkdir test2、把simsun字体复制到test目录下$cp  /

2013-12-18 15:45:15 1677

转载 关于matlab 中libsvm中model中的保存与调用新发现

最近一直在用matlab和libsvm,发现libsvm库用起来还是很方便的,就是没有模型直接保存到文件和读取模型的matlab接口(C++的接口有)。由于有会用的Opencv等C/C++库,所以数据交换比较麻烦。看了一下libsvm的svm.h、svm.cpp文件,发现有svm_save_model(),svm_load_model()等函数。于是乎用mex小做封装,写了两个matlab可以直接

2013-12-18 15:02:24 1072

原创 Ubuntu安装或者运行时Matlab找不到libc.so.6

ln -s /lib/x86_64-linux-gnu/libc.so.6 /lib64/libc.so.6

2013-12-10 19:42:24 1290

原创 ubuntu中ls等命令失效(段错误,核已转载)

今天安装glibc最后报错,最后导致命令行不能用,命令行的命令都错了,那个郁闷最后解决方案:lib继续使用之前的 和lib64使用ubuntu光盘中的llib64替代。用ubuntu光盘启动,进入try ubuntu中,然后命令行操作替换lib64

2013-12-10 19:09:32 4255

原创 打开无线网命令

sudo rmmod acer_wmi

2013-12-10 19:06:12 586

转载 解决libXp.so.6找不到的问题

一般服务器上都不装X环境的,不过有些变态的程序却要用到X环境的组件:比如java写的Tidy,oracle的安装程序。一般遇到这种情况,偷懒的人都直接rpm或apt-get到libXp.so.6来装。不过我喜欢什么都在自己的掌握中,不喜欢装到哪都不知道的感觉(Slackware甚至不支持rpm,我太欣赏了)。其实libXp.so.6只是XFree86的一个很小的库,根本没必要装整个X。自己动手,乐

2013-12-10 19:05:27 6595

转载 在 linux(ubuntu) 下 安装 LibSVM

在安装LibSVM前需要先装 python 和 gnuplotlinux 一般都自带了python2.7,所以python的安装不再赘述在 ubuntu 下安装 gnuplot 不能直接 sudo apt-get install gnuplot,因为预编译的gnuplot不能识别ubuntu的图形界面,所以必须先运行这句:[plain] view pla

2013-12-10 19:04:54 810

转载 matlab 2010a linux 安装过程

matlab安装过程还是比较简单的,环境:fedora 12 x86_64   matlab for unix 2010a下面是具体的方法:第一步:下载光盘镜像,下载地址:ed2k://|file|%5B%E7%9F%A9%E9%98%B5%E5%AE%9E%E9%AA%8C%E5%AE%A4%5D.TLF-SOFT-Mathworks.Matlab.R2010a.UNIX.I

2013-12-10 19:04:20 759

转载 centos 6.4 QT5 的安装,找不到GLIBCXX_3.4.15的解决办法

下载安装后 启动的时候提示 GLIBCXX_3.4.15,发现libstdc++.so.6的版本过,在安装qt-creator的时候运行这个IDE就出现了这个问题,是由于libstdc++.so.6的版本过低,需要下载个新的重新建立软连接。我这里是 更新里 gcc 版本到 4.8 解决的,更新之后做里链接  ln -s /usr/lib/libstdc++.so.6

2013-12-10 19:03:07 872

转载 安装GCC-4.6.1详细教程

一、什么是GccLinux系统下的Gcc(GNU C Compiler)是GNU推出的功能强大、性能优越的多平台编译器,是GNU的代表作品之一。gcc是可以在多种硬体平台上编译出可执行程序的超级编译器,其执行效率与一般的编译器相比平均效率要高20%~30%。Gcc编译器能将C、C++语言源程序、汇程式化序和目标程序编译、连接成可执行文件,如果没有给出可执行文件的名字,gcc将生

2013-12-10 19:02:41 714

转载 jsoncpp在linux下的配置

JSON 官方的解释为:JSON 是一种轻量级的数据传输格式。关于 JSON 更具体的信息,可参见 JSON 官网:http://www.json.org。jsoncpp 是比较出名的 C++ JSON 解析库。在 JSON 官网也是首推的。下载地址为:http://sourceforge.net/projects/jsoncpp。下面开始说明配置方法:1、

2013-12-10 19:01:51 613

转载 Remote Access to the CentOS Desktop

PreviousTable of ContentsNextBasic CentOS Firewall Configuration Configuring CentOS Remote Access using SSHeBookFrenzy.comPurchase and download the full

2013-12-10 19:01:15 1101

转载 OpenCV中IplImage图像格式与 BYTE图像数据的转换

IplImage* iplImage;BYTE* data.1. 由IplImage*得到BYTE*图像数据:data = iplImage->imageDataOrigin; //未对齐的原始图像数据或者data = iplImage->imageData; //已对齐的图像数据2. 由BYTE*得到IplImage*图像数据iplImage = cvCrea

2013-12-10 18:59:47 976

转载 C#将exe运行程序嵌入到自己的winform窗体中

http://blog.csdn.net/bigeyescat/archive/2010/10/26/5966540.aspx 以下例子是将Word打开,然后将它嵌入到winform窗体中,效果如下图:注意:该方法只适用于com的exe(如word,Excel之类),.net的编的exe就不能用这用方法嵌入到窗体中。using System;using System.Col

2013-12-10 18:59:04 2659

转载 Ubuntu 12.10 安装运行 Office 2010

摘要: office在Ubuntu上一直是一个头痛的问题,目前比较好的解决方案一个是永中office,一个是正在开发的wps for linux,还有一个deepin论坛中的wine office2003。这个wine 的office版本比较老,而且功能比较简单。  在U ...  office在Ubuntu上一直是一个头痛的问题,目前比较好的解决方

2013-12-10 18:58:32 878

转载 [转]Ubuntu下编译安装Qt-4.8.2

一 、源代码的获取。官网http://qt.nokia.com/downloads,最新的是4.8.2版本。二、解压代码tar zxvf qt-everywhere-opensource-src-4.8.2.tar.gz解压完进入解压后的源代码文件夹三、执行./configure生成makefile./configure -prefix /usr/l

2013-12-10 18:57:58 511

转载 Linux 下编译安装OpenCV

Cmake的安装OpenCV 2.2以后版本需要使用Cmake生成makefile文件,因此需要先安装cmake。ubuntu下安装cmake比较简单,apt-get install cmake如果觉得自带的版本不符合要求,可以下载安装包。下载最新版的安装包:http://www.cmake.org/cmake/resources/software.html这里

2013-12-10 18:57:16 464

原创 Silverlight 中绘制扇形(前台+后台)

以Y轴正方向为0度,顺时针递增,我们来做一个40度角的扇形,对称轴是Y轴。 前台:利用Blend 1、按住shift画出一个圆形,去掉生成的Ellipse对象的Margin、Stroke属性,添加 Width, Height属性值(目的为了能比较准确的切割)。 Ellipse Fill = #FFF4F4F5 Width = 200 Height = 200 / 2、在画一个矩形,去掉生成的Rec

2013-12-10 18:56:42 653

转载 WPF学习之路--WPF BitmapEffect

BitmapEffect位图效果是简单的像素处理操作。它可以呈现下面几种特殊效果。             BevelBitmapEffect        凹凸效果            BlurBitmapEffect         模糊效果            DropShadowBitmapEffect 投影效果            EmbossBitmapEffec

2013-12-10 18:56:12 698

opencv教程

opencv的学习文档,很好很使用,内容丰富

2013-05-28

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除